Transaction 66981ccd075e3e94057d256b7950c90e6745e9a87a07ba8c5302e8f16ad0c60f
1 Input
1 Output
-
66981ccd075e3e94057d256b7950c90e6745e9a87a07ba8c5302e8f16ad0c60f:0
- value
- 5910885
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 833213c42650f797a90e9d8628d88f18d88044c6 OP_EQUAL
- address
- 3DeiS6hzjFJKtRMj1hXuCNHShyXTfXZ4Ei